With a new year, we will be starting a new book! We will be reading Jim Korkis’ The Vault of Walt. Jim Korkis has been a guest on WDW Radio discussing Disney history and the stories he is working so hard to preserve.

The Vault of Walt is organized in themes. Each theme contains stories, anecdotes, and quotes that Jim has saved from being lost forever. We will be following the themes and choosing a few stories to enjoy each week.

In order to give book club readers time to order, receive and begin reading The Vault of Walt, we will start posting about this book on January 22nd, 2012.
